Unsafe Condition
Potential failures within the yaw damper system could cause sudden uncommanded yawing of the airplane, leading to injury to passengers and crewmembers.

Required Actions
Conduct a one-time inspection to determine the part number of the engage solenoid valve of the yaw damper. Replace the valve with a valve having a different part number if necessary.
